Job Description
Senior Software Implementation Consultant
Dayshape
Role Description We are looking to further grow our professional services team in the US to support the onboarding of our new enterprise customers. We are looking for a senior team member who is experienced in driving complex software implementation projects. - Bring a consultative mindset and demonstrate expertise in leading complex scoping workshops with Resource Management and IT teams. - Hands-on in data mapping and configuration, ensuring customers get the most out of our product. - Active learners who apply their growing expertise in Dayshape, Resource Management, and the complex needs of Professional Services customers. - Enjoy winning the hearts and minds of senior customer stakeholders and leveraging experience to develop internal and external processes. - Problem-solver, independently figuring out how to solve novel challenges and bring about business transformation. - Join a fast-growing US professional services team, currently at nine members. - Anticipate a few days of travel each quarter to customer sites as required through the course of the project. Qualifications - Extensive experience in a similar role involving consultative SaaS implementations. - A blend of soft and technical skills to effectively analyze business needs. - Significant experience working with or within large global enterprises, including accountancy, professional services firms, media agencies, or IT consultancies. - Hands-on experience configuring complex software solutions and designing integrations with CRM and ERP solutions. - Strong customer-facing skills; ability to win hearts and minds and guide stakeholders through complex business change. - A consultative attitude and demonstrable experience delivering solutions to customers' requirements. - The ability to contextualize pain points in a customer's business and apply and configure Dayshape to drive meaningful efficiencies and improvements. - A logical and analytical approach to problem-solving. - Experience mentoring less experienced team members. - Confidence deputizing for a Project Manager when needed. - A seasoned remote worker with experience in a geographically distributed team. - The ability and attitude to contribute from day one! Requirements - Experience implementing Workday or other PSA solutions. - Experience working in resource management and/or the accounting industry. - Experience leading current-state and future-state workshops as part of an implementation project. - Implementation pre-sales (solution consultant) experience. Benefits - Salary c. $85,000 - $125,000 dependent on experience. - 31 days' vacation per year, including public holidays, increasing by 1 day each year to a maximum of 38 days. - Paid four-week sabbatical in your fifth anniversary year on top of your holiday entitlement. -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ision benefits. - Disability and life insurance. - 401k. - At least $1,400 per year to spend on professional and personal development. - Regular All Hands meeting for inspiration and over-communication. - Monthly team events (sometimes in-person, sometimes virtual). - Volunteering time – up to 20 hours a year to participate in volunteer work. - Genuinely nice, smart people to work with, who are excited about growing our company. Company Description Dayshape is an award-winning software scale-up with big ambitions and the momentum to match. Trusted by Big Four and many other top professional services firms globally, our AI-powered resource management platform is helping organizations to achieve extraordinary results. - We help professional firms optimize margins and increase revenue, unlocking access to more profitable work. - We provide complete operational visibility today and the tools to confidently predict tomorrow. - We empower firms to become the places where top talent wants to work and the best clients want to work with.
